Hotel Naira - La Paz
-16.496889, -68.137435Overview
Located at the foot of mountains, the 3-star Hotel Naira La Paz welcomes guests with a patio and a picnic area. Offering hiking and cycling in the area, the hotel lies a mere 7 minutes on foot from Calle Sagarnaga, and just a 7-minute stroll from St. Peter's Square.
Location
Nestled in the centre of La Paz, the accommodation is also within sight of San Francisco Church. The nearby cultural attractions are National Museum of Ethnography and Folklore (950 metres) and Museum of Musical Instruments (0.9 km). There is Mirador Killi Killi a 13-minute walk away, while Parada a Pinaya bus station around 5 minutes on foot from this La Paz hotel.
Guests will find Estacion Obelisco / Utjawi cable car station within walking distance of Hotel Naira.
Rooms
The property offers 10 spacious rooms, some of them comprise an adjoining terrace and a balcony. They are furnished with spacious decor.
Eat & Drink
Treat yourself to a daily breakfast with pastries, fresh fruits, and fruit salads served in the restaurant. Guests can also enjoy Mexican food at Kalakitas Mexican Food n' Drinks located nearby, it is a 5-minute walk away.
